root/luci/trunk/contrib/package/iwinfo/Makefile @ 6255

Revision 6255, 1.2 KB (checked in by jow, 3 years ago)

[libiwinfo] fix typo in Makefile

Line 
1#
2# Copyright (C) 2010 Jo-Philipp Wich <xm@subsignal.org>
3#
4# This is free software, licensed under the GPL 2 license.
5#
6
7include $(TOPDIR)/rules.mk
8
9PKG_NAME:=libiwinfo
10PKG_RELEASE:=1
11
12PKG_BUILD_DIR := $(BUILD_DIR)/$(PKG_NAME)
13
14include $(INCLUDE_DIR)/package.mk
15
16
17define Package/libiwinfo
18  SECTION:=luci
19  CATEGORY:=LuCI
20  SUBMENU:=Libraries
21  TITLE:=Generalized Wireless Information Library (iwinfo)
22  DEPENDS:=+libnl-tiny +liblua +lua
23endef
24
25define Package/libiwinfo/description
26  Wireless information library with consistent interface for proprietary Broadcom,
27  madwifi, nl80211 and wext driver interfaces.
28endef
29
30define Build/Prepare
31    mkdir -p $(PKG_BUILD_DIR)
32    $(CP) ./src/* $(PKG_BUILD_DIR)/
33endef
34
35define Build/Configure
36endef
37
38TARGET_CFLAGS += \
39    -I$(STAGING_DIR)/usr/include \
40    -I$(STAGING_DIR)/usr/include/libnl-tiny
41
42MAKE_FLAGS += \
43    FPIC="$(FPIC)" \
44    CFLAGS="$(TARGET_CFLAGS)" \
45    LDFLAGS="$(TARGET_LDFLAGS)"
46
47define Package/libiwinfo/install
48    $(INSTALL_DIR) $(1)/usr/bin
49    $(INSTALL_BIN) $(PKG_BUILD_DIR)/iwinfo.lua $(1)/usr/bin/iwinfo
50    $(INSTALL_DIR) $(1)/usr/lib/lua
51    $(INSTALL_BIN) $(PKG_BUILD_DIR)/iwinfo.so $(1)/usr/lib/lua/iwinfo.so
52endef
53
54$(eval $(call BuildPackage,libiwinfo))
55
Note: See TracBrowser for help on using the browser.